I'm not sure if this is a bug or a feature I'm not using correctly, but either way it's driving me crazy. When I try to use labels with custom paths, the letters are spaced miles apart and the text ends up getting cut off. This happens regardless of path, font size, or alignment. Is there a way to fix this? It makes custom path more or less unusable.

I was able to replicate the problem with a 4K monitor. It seems to be an issue with resolution that's messing with the letter spacing and that's making the text longer than the path. We've been working on more support for high resolution monitors, so I'll add this to our list. For the time being, you might be able to make the path longer with the transform tool. That should stop it from getting cut off. Thank you for pointing this out!

The tool tray text getting cut off is also on our list. It's somewhat fixed by changing the icon size, . In Settings->Size Settings... change the Menu and Tool Icons to Large. Please let us know if that doesn't work or you notice anything else!
